환경 설정/자주 사용하는 소프트웨어 모음

✍🏼 작성일 2016년 07월 08일   
❗️ 참고: 이 글이 작성된 지 이미 일이 지났습니다. 시의성에 유의하세요

서문

새 컴퓨터를 받을 때마다 항상 여러 도구들을 설치하느라 정신이 없고, 가끔은 필요한 소프트웨어를 깜빡하고 설치하지 않아 사용할 때가 되어서야 다운로드하게 됩니다. 특히 처음 직장에 들어갔을 때 상사가 가장 먼저 시키는 일이 "먼저 환경에 익숙해지고, 자신의 컴퓨터를 설정하세요"인 경우가 많습니다. 따라서 이 글은 제가 자주 사용하는 소프트웨어들을 기록해 두어 필요할 때 참고할 수 있도록 합니다.

본문

QQ/OneNote 위챗/네이버 뮤직Mac App의 인기 무료 소프트웨어에서 직접 다운로드할 수 있습니다.

  1. Shadowsocks는 바이두 클라우드에 저장되어 있으며, 다음 단계에서 Chrome을 다운로드하기 위해 사용됩니다.

  2. 썬더는 Safari의 기본 다운로드 도구로 뒤에 나오는 소프트웨어를 다운로드하면 매우 느립니다.

  3. Chrome

  4. WebStorm 활성화 서버: `http://idea.iteblog.com/key.php``

  5. Sublime3

    1. 활성화 key:
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
       —– BEGIN LICENSE —–
    Nicolas Hennion
    Single User License
    EA7E-866075
    8A01AA83 1D668D24 4484AEBC 3B04512C
    827B0DE5 69E9B07A A39ACCC0 F95F5410
    729D5639 4C37CECB B2522FB3 8D37FDC1
    72899363 BBA441AC A5F47F08 6CD3B3FE
    CEFB3783 B2E1BA96 71AAF7B4 AFB61B1D
    0CC513E7 52FF2333 9F726D2C CDE53B4A
    810C0D4F E1F419A3 CDA0832B 8440565A
    35BF00F6 4CA9F869 ED10E245 469C233E
    —— END LICENSE ——
    1. 사이드바 강화 도구 SideBarEnhancements 설치

      command+shift+p를 누르고 install을 입력한 후 엔터를 누르고, 다시 command+shift+p를 누르고 SideBarEn을 입력한 후 엔터를 누릅니다.

    2. Sublime 플러그인 Terminal 설치(Sublime에서 Terminal 열기)
      command+shift+p를 누르고 Terminal을 입력한 후 엔터를 누릅니다.

      설정 “terminal”: "iTerm2-v3.sh"로 iTerm2에서 현재 파일 열기

  6. iTerm2

    1
    ssh -p 端口 用户名@ip
  7. Node

  8. Oh My Zsh

    1
    sh -c "$(curl -fsSL https://raw.github.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"
  9. git

    1
    2
    3
    公钥配置: ssh-keygen -t rsa -b 4096 -C "your_email@example.com"
    配置用户: git config --global user.name "Xheldon"
    配置邮箱: git config --global user.email "c1006044256@gmail.com"
  10. sougou 입력기

  11. charles 패킷 캡처 도구, 다운로드한 패치로 charles.jar를 교체하면 크랙 완료.

  12. XCode 일부 기능은 cli에 의존합니다.

  13. homebrew 설치

    1
    /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
  14. 로컬 Jekyll 환경 설정

    ruby는 2.1 이상 버전이 필요합니다.

    1. rvm 설치(시간이 조금 걸리며, 기기가 뜨거워질 수 있음)

      1
      \curl -sSL https://get.rvm.io \| bash -s stable --ruby

      이후 모든 shell을 닫고 다음 단계를 진행하거나, source /Users/Xheldon/.rvm/scripts/rvm을 실행한 후 다음 단계를 진행합니다.

    2. 알려진 ruby 버전 확인

      1
      rvm list known
    3. ruby2.2.0 설치

      1
      rvm install 2.2.0

      설치 중에 mkdir -p /tec/openssl 권한이 필요하므로 비밀번호를 입력해야 합니다.

    4. gem source 변경:

      1
      2
      3
      gem sources -l //查看当前源
      gem source --remote https://rubygems.org/ //移除当前源
      gem source -a https://gems.ruby-china.org //新增源
    5. bundler 설치

      1
      gem install bundler
    6. jekyll 및 기타 종속성 설치.

      프로젝트 루트 디렉토리로 이동(이미 jekyll 블로그를 clone했다고 가정) 후 실행:

      1
      bundle install

      완료 후 bundle exec jekyll serve를 실행하여 로컬 jekyll을 확인할 수 있습니다(bundle 명령어를 찾을 수 없다는 오류가 발생하면 5, 6단계를 다시 실행하세요).

기타

필요할 수 있는 작업:

  1. 모든 설치 출처 허용:
    1
    sudo spctl --master-disable
- EOF -
이 글의 최초 게시: 환경 설정/자주 사용하는 소프트웨어 모음 - Xheldon Blog